大数跨境

小白入门OpenClaw(龙虾)本地开发汇总

2026-03-19 0
详情
报告
跨境服务
文章

引言

小白入门OpenClaw(龙虾)本地开发汇总 是指面向中国跨境卖家,围绕 OpenClaw(业内俗称“龙虾”)这一开源电商开发框架,整理的本地化部署、调试、二次开发及对接主流平台(如Shopify、Amazon、独立站等)的实操指南集合。OpenClaw 是一个基于 Rust + TypeScript 构建的高性能电商中间件/开发框架,非 SaaS 工具,也非平台或服务商,其核心定位是本地可私有化部署的开源开发套件,用于构建定制化订单履约、库存同步、多渠道 API 聚合等能力。

 

主体

它能解决哪些问题

  • 场景痛点:多平台 API 差异大、SDK 维护成本高 → 对应价值:提供统一抽象层(如 Order、Inventory、Fulfillment 接口),屏蔽 Shopify、WooCommerce、Shopee 等平台底层协议差异,降低多渠道接入开发复杂度。
  • 场景痛点:ERP 或自研系统需高频调用海外平台接口,但受限于限流/认证/重试机制 → 对应价值:内置自动重试、令牌刷新、请求节流、Webhook 签名校验等生产级中间件能力,减少重复造轮子。
  • 场景痛点:团队无 Rust 经验,但希望利用高性能服务支撑高并发订单处理 → 对应价值:提供 Docker Compose 一键启动模板、CLI 初始化命令、TypeScript 客户端 SDK 及中文注释示例,降低 Rust 技术栈入门门槛。

怎么用/怎么开通/怎么选择

OpenClaw 不提供托管服务,不涉及“开通”或“注册”,而是本地下载、编译、配置、部署。常见流程如下(以 v0.8.x 版本为准):

  1. 访问 GitHub 官方仓库(github.com/openclaw/openclaw),确认 License(MIT)、Release 版本及 README.md 中的最低 Rust 版本要求(通常 ≥1.75);
  2. 使用 cargo install --git https://github.com/openclaw/openclaw 或克隆仓库后执行 cargo build --release 编译二进制
  3. 复制 config.example.yamlconfig.yaml,按需填写各平台 OAuth 凭据、Webhook 秘钥、数据库连接串(PostgreSQL);
  4. 运行 openclaw serve 启动服务,默认监听 http://localhost:8080,API 文档自动托管在 /docs
  5. 通过提供的 @openclaw/client TypeScript 包,在前端或 Node.js 服务中调用统一接口(如 createOrder());
  6. 如需对接新平台(如 LazadaCoupang),需实现 PlatformAdapter trait 并注册到路由,具体参考 adapters/ 目录下已有实现。

⚠️ 注意:所有配置与数据均运行于本地或私有服务器,不上传至任何第三方;平台凭证仅用于本地服务鉴权,无云端账号绑定环节。

费用/成本通常受哪些因素影响

  • 是否需额外购买 PostgreSQL 托管服务(如 AWS RDS、阿里云 PolarDB);
  • 是否需自建 CI/CD 流水线(GitHub Actions / GitLab CI)支持自动化构建与部署;
  • 团队是否具备 Rust 基础或需外部技术顾问支持(社区无官方付费支持,仅提供 Discord 讨论区);
  • 是否需定制适配未覆盖平台(如 TikTok Shop 官方 API 尚未内置 adapter);
  • 是否启用可选模块(如 Redis 缓存、Prometheus 监控集成),带来基础设施依赖成本。

为了拿到准确部署与维护成本,你通常需要准备:Rust 运行环境版本、目标部署环境(Docker/K8s/裸机)、对接平台清单、日均订单量级、SLA 要求(如 99.9% 可用性)

常见坑与避坑清单

  • ❌ 忽略时区配置:OpenClaw 默认使用 UTC 处理时间戳,若未在 config.yaml 中设置 timezone: "Asia/Shanghai",可能导致订单创建时间错位,影响财务对账;
  • ❌ 直接使用 example 配置上线:config.example.yaml 含明文测试密钥和默认 DB 地址(localhost),必须替换为生产凭据并启用 TLS;
  • ❌ 未启用 Webhook 签名验证:Shopify/TikTok 等平台强制要求校验 X-Hub-Signature-256,需在 config 中开启 webhook.verify_signature: true 并填入对应密钥;
  • ❌ 误将 OpenClaw 当作 ERP 使用:它不提供商品管理、采购、财务模块,仅为 API 协议层桥梁,需与现有 ERP(如店小秘、马帮、自研系统)配合使用。

FAQ

{关键词} 靠谱吗/正规吗/是否合规?

OpenClaw 是 MIT 协议开源项目,代码完全公开,无闭源插件或隐藏调用。其设计符合 GDPR/CCPA 数据最小化原则(不采集用户数据),所有接口调用行为由使用者自主控制。合规性取决于你如何使用——例如是否在 config 中合法存储平台 token、是否对 Webhook payload 做脱敏处理。建议审计自身部署方案是否满足目标市场(如欧盟、美国)的数据出境要求。

{关键词} 适合哪些卖家/平台/地区/类目?

适合具备基础技术能力的中大型跨境卖家或 ISV:已自建系统或使用开源 ERP(如 Odoo)、需对接 ≥3 个海外电商平台、有 Rust/TS 开发资源或愿意投入学习成本。目前稳定支持 Shopify、WooCommerce、BigCommerce、Amazon MWS/SP-API(需自行配置 IAM 角色)。暂未原生支持 Temu、Shein、速卖通(AliExpress API 需手动扩展)。对类目无限制,但高定制化需求(如虚拟商品分账、B2B 批量报价)需自行开发 adapter。

{关键词} 怎么开通/注册/接入/购买?需要哪些资料?

OpenClaw 不提供注册、开通或购买流程——它不是 SaaS 服务,无需账号。接入即部署:你需要一台 Linux 服务器(或 Docker 环境)、Rust 编译工具链、PostgreSQL 实例、各电商平台的开发者账号及 API Key。所需资料仅限技术侧:平台 OAuth Client ID/Secret、Webhook Signing Secret、PostgreSQL 连接 URL。无营业执照、品牌资质等商务材料要求。

结尾

OpenClaw(龙虾)是技术自驱型卖家构建多平台统一履约能力的可靠开源基座,非开箱即用工具,需匹配相应工程投入。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业